Professional Background
Dalva Moellenberg is a distinguished lawyer based in Santa Fe, New Mexico, with extensive experience in various facets of environmental law, mining law, oil and gas law, water law, agricultural law, and wildlife law. Her legal expertise extends to public lands, administrative law, hearings, and appellate practice. A highly respected member of the legal community, Dalva is licensed to practice in New Mexico, Arizona, and federal courts, demonstrating her wide-reaching impact in environmental legal matters across state lines.
In her role as an attorney at Gallagher & Kennedy, Dalva expertly navigates complex legal landscapes involving environmental regulations and rulemaking procedures. She is adept at assisting clients with intricate permitting processes for large-scale mining operations and other facilities. Dalva is highly skilled in representing clients during permit hearings and appeals, and she actively defends against administrative and judicial enforcement actions, ensuring that her clients are well-represented in all legal matters.
Through her career, Dalva has negotiated and settled complicated cases pertaining to environmental cleanups under the Comprehensive Environmental Response, Compensation, and Liability Act (CERCLA) and comparable state programs. Her extensive involvement in natural resource damage claims speaks to her ability to handle multifaceted legal challenges and achieve successful resolutions for her clients.
